Description: Job Summary Under the direction of the Director of Development, College of Liberal Arts (CLA), the Development Associate maintains a portfolio of prospects, directly soliciting gifts to support the CLA, creates relationships with college alumni, corporations, foundations, volunteers, and external constituents, stewards CLA donors, and provides administrative assistance and support at alumni, donor and prospect events. Key Responsibilities The Development Associate maintains a portfolio of donor prospects and solicits annual leadership and major gifts up to $100,000. This position will raise $100,000+ per year. Provides project and administrative support, including but not limited to, basic clerical functions, event and project coordination, and prospect research. Will coordinate with the CLA scholarship liaison on the scholarship process and donor relations, writing relevant materials in support of fundraising initiatives, and managing the planning and administration of development events in support of college departments, schools and programs. Assists the Director of Development in writing solicitation letters, letters of gratitude, contact reports, proposals, newsletters, publications and other relevant materials in support of fundraising initiatives. The development associate will manage and supervise student assistant(s) and/or CLA student intern(s). Knowledge Skills and Abilities
Education and Experience Equivalent to a bachelor's degree in a related field and two years of related experience required. Higher Education and fundraising experience preferred. Possess a valid CA Driver's license.
